A shocking incident took place at a renowned school in Gwalior, Madhya Pradesh, where a Class VII student was allegedly sodomised by a senior schoolmate, according to a police official.

The horrifying event occurred on Saturday in the washroom of the school's health centre, the official added.

Following a complaint from the school's principal, the accused, who is in Class IX, has been charged under various provisions of the Protection of Children from Sexual Offences (POCSO) Act, Additional Superintendent of Police Niranjan Sharma informed reporters.

Both the 12-year-old victim and the accused are minors and reside in the school's hostel, as per police records.

The school management has yet to release an official statement regarding the incident.
